摘要
在传统的浮码头散货工艺系统基础上,结合水文、地质条件,提出了浮式钢引桥皮带机方案,即采用浮趸替代升降架,将钢引桥直接固定在浮趸上,利用水的浮力自动升降浮趸及钢引桥,将趸船、多个浮趸、多跨钢引桥钢引桥上皮带机串联成一整套的浮式结构。
        Based on bulk cargo process system of conventional pontoon, a design proposal of belt conveyor with floating steel approach bridge has been put forward by referring to local oceanographic and geological conditions. As a creative option, pontoon is used to replace crane, and steel approach bridge is fixed directly on the pontoon. The pontoon and steel approach bridge rise and fall through water buoyancy, and a whole floating structure is formed, which connects pontoons, multi-span steel approach bridge and belt conveyor in series.
